He Sang remembered that Liang Jishen ordered Cheng Xun to investigate the two brothers on the construction site, but they moved out of the village overnight, abandoning their wives and children.

Obviously received the message in advance.

The person who leaked the information must be the mastermind behind the accident at the city wall tower.

If He Jinping's death was just an accident, why were the migrant workers hiding?

Guanghe Group has been in debt and has disappeared for six years. In February, it planned to go public for the second time using the empty shell of "Wanhe Group". It can be said that it is very well-connected and very bold.

Even if Liang Chihui had great skills, it would be impossible for him to hold up an entire group on his own. He owned Yunhai Tower, a bank, and also managed the Liang Group. Where did he get the energy and time?

In all likelihood, Liang Yanzhang and he each controlled a part of it.

The beam of the city wall tower fell and killed He Jinping. It is currently unknown who was the mastermind.

However, Liang Jishen must not interfere.

After all, he is in the Ming Dynasty.

Liang Yanzhang and Liang Chihui monitored his every move. As soon as he found any clues, disaster would strike immediately, ruining his reputation and future. He would be trapped and suppressed by false "charges".

He was buried in vain.

Moreover, they are now in opposition between good and evil. The evil side is on full alert, and Liang Jishen can no longer find any clues.

Years have passed, things have changed, the case files are incomplete, and the real evidence has sunk into the sea. The only way to dig out evidence is to infiltrate the core and board the ship.

Liang Yanzhang and Liang Chihui are very cautious people. To become their confidant, one must go through many tests. This is also the key to Guanghe Group's survival for many years.

Colleagues, opponents, not even an undercover agent can get in.

All secrets are locked inside the group and are airtight.

They are too shrewd and too vigilant.

He Sang felt her chest stop beating, her lungs shattered, and a stream of molten lava flowed out of her blood vessels, swallowing her in an instant.

There is no escape.

"Will people on the same ship be wary of each other?"

Hu Nongnong said, "Liang Chihui is widely recognized for his cunning and meticulous approach to his work. Liang Yanzhang trusts and values him greatly. Both the Liang Group and the Guanghe Group owe their success to Liang Chihui. Would you be wary of your right-hand man?"

He Sang tilted his head, "But Liang Chihui will be wary of Liang Yanzhang. If Liang Yanzhang is the culprit, Liang Chihui will collect and preserve physical evidence, and the Second House will be determined to retaliate against him."

Hu Nongnong woke up as if from a dream, "You want to get close to Liang Chihui?"

Liang Jishen and Zhou Kun swam three rounds in the swimming pool, then came ashore and walked towards this side.

He Sang's face was pale. Her skin was originally white, and now it was even whiter, and there was no trace of vitality in her.

His heart ached and he held her cold hand.

"What's wrong?"

She said nothing, but subconsciously held his hand.

The man gritted his teeth, suppressing his irritability, "Did you choke on water?"

He Sang shook his head.

Hu Nongnong was feeling guilty, "Nothing..."

Liang Jishen was impatient, "What happened to her?"

His violent temper is actually not scary. When it flares up, it leaves room for maneuver. The calmer the situation is, the more intimidating and terrifying it is.

I don't know how much intense anger is bubbling beneath the calm surface.

Hu Nongnong couldn't help but shiver, "Third Aunt..."

"I'm not feeling well," He Sang said. "I got cramps from kicking my legs in the water."

Liang Jishen's expression softened considerably. "Going home?"

She nodded.

After coming out of the swimming pool and getting in the car, Liang Jishen held her between his legs and stroked her face. "You don't like learning to swim, so I won't teach you anymore. Be happy."

He Sang looked at him, as if he was a lost lamb caught in a big net, worthy of pity.

"I'm just teasing you. Next time if you don't want to do anything, I won't force you, okay?"

Her eyes were red, "No..."

"What's that?" Liang Jishen pouted her cheeks, making them pointed. "Your face is drooping. Are you angry?"

She lowered her eyelids, and the man bent his legs to hold her up, his trousers being rubbed into wrinkles by her buttocks.

"If you don't investigate Guanghe Group, Mrs. Zhao won't harm you, and the suppliers won't cheat you. It's Director Liang who doesn't want you to investigate, setting a trap to hinder you and teach you a lesson. If you continue investigating, his tricks to torment you will become more and more ruthless, right?"

Liang Jishen narrowed his eyes and stared at her without saying a word.

"Li Zhen once told me that the most compassionate people in this world are ordinary people. Fathers love their sons, sons are filial to their mothers, and couples stay together until old age. Without power or influence, human nature is kind, but once they become rich and powerful, human nature changes. Many prominent families fight and kill each other, competing and scheming, family affection fades, and couples become alienated."

He Sang's heart kept falling and collapsing. "Especially the Liang family, three wives, three sons. Some are fighting for the family property, some for hatred. They have been entangled in grievances for a lifetime."

"He Sang." Liang Jishen called her in a hoarse voice.

"Listen to me." She spoke with tears in her eyes, emphasizing each word. "I want you to know that I'm not plotting against you. I'm not alienated from you. I'm sincere in my feelings."

Liang Jishen was amused by her and nodded.

He Sang laughed and cried, and a bubble of snot came out of his nose.

The man pointed at her nose and said, "You do it again."

"I couldn't help it..."

"Wipe it yourself."

She wiped it off with the back of her hand, leaving a wet, transparent line of water on her cheekbones.

Liang Jishen had a grim expression.

"You despise me." He Sang hugged him tightly and cried silently, not wanting to show him her appearance.

"I don't mind." She had a sweet and lingering body odor, and Liang Jishen hugged her, "I'll let you wipe my snot."

He Sang buried his head in his shoulder, laughing and crying tremblingly.

The car drove into the old house. The living room was empty. Old Zheng greeted them at the entrance. "Director Liang had a relapse of high blood pressure at noon and passed out in the study."

Liang Jishen glanced calmly at the second floor and asked, "Has the doctor been here?"

"Intravenous drip in the master bedroom."

He took off his coat. "Is it that serious?"

Old Zheng said, "Not really. It was Madam Ji who was worried about Director Liang and asked for a transfusion."

In the master bedroom, Yao Wenjie and Ji Xilan stood by the bed, one wiping tears and the other talking calmly to the doctor. Liang Chihui was contacting the medical team in the United States to discuss chartering a flight.

He walked towards the door while talking on the phone. When they passed each other, Liang Jishen nodded. He also nodded. His eyes passed by He Sang, paused for a second, and then looked away.

Liang Jishen walked towards Ji Xilan who was crying bitterly. He Sang squatted down and picked up something from the blanket: a brown leather buckle with the Bentley Mulsanne logo.

It's Liang Chihui's car key.

She held it in her palm.

While the room was in chaos, he quietly left.

It just so happened that Liang Chihui hadn't left yet and was at the bottom of the stairs at the corner.

"Second brother."

The man stopped and turned sideways.

She was on the stairs, shaking the leather buckle, "You dropped your car keys."

The afternoon sun shone through the window and slanted down onto the stairs. Liang Chihui's shadow was extremely long, as if coated with a layer of warm light, a mixture of light and darkness that highlighted his elegance and grace.

It also hides an inextricable darkness, deep.

From his most secret bones and blood.

"Why don't you ask the servant to deliver it?"

Sister Fang and Sister Rong were both serving in the master bedroom.

She walked down the stairs and stood just a few feet away from him. "It's the same for me to deliver it as it is for them to deliver it. I just need to deliver it to Second Brother."

Liang Chihui faced the light, his face clear and bright, his sharp eyes unfathomable, as if to pierce through her, reach her soul, and discern her intentions.

He Sang smiled, impeccable, "Second brother?"

He came to his senses, reached out and grabbed the key.

Inadvertently, their fingertips touched.
